Output 70cf77ddac8f4a5548c9ecf6902a617bd5ad073afe1482dd74c4d1c21a5d8b62: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 e05f525368599a9331b47bb5cf9a80071398a3ad
address
tb1qup04y5mgtxdfxvd50w6ulx5qqufe3gadfg8whh
transaction
70cf77ddac8f4a5548c9ecf6902a617bd5ad073afe1482dd74c4d1c21a5d8b62
confirmations
59856
spent
true